New album: Hawel/McPhail || Sorrow Wonderland

Fuzz pedals and hard truths

On their sophomore album, Hamburg, Germany-based indie rock veterans Rick McPhail (Mint Mind, Tocotronic) and Frehn Hawel (Tigerbeat) take us to Sorrow Wonderland. It lies somewhere between grit and grace, floating on meaning and a stubborn sense of purpose. We discover twelve tracks of wiry garage rock, performed with a vicious punk intensity. Guitars bite, rhythms groove, vocals feel urgent, but there’s also a quiet acceptance underneath it all.

Covered in fuzz and captured in a GbVfi-like sound, this is one of those records that gets better and better with every spin. The first listen intrigues, the second draws you in, by the third you’re still uncovering new details, and before you know it, you’re fully hooked.




Sorrow Wonderland—recorded, mixed, and mastered by Richard Arthur McPhail—is out now digitally and on vinyl LP through La Pochette Surprise Records.
